20 lines
895 B
Bash
Executable File
20 lines
895 B
Bash
Executable File
#!/usr/bin/env bash
|
|
|
|
NAME=$1
|
|
|
|
echo "### Stop odoo service"
|
|
multipass exec $NAME -- sudo systemctl stop odoo12
|
|
|
|
echo "### Remove old repostitories"
|
|
multipass exec $NAME -- sudo rm -r /home/ubuntu/odoo12
|
|
multipass exec $NAME -- sudo rm -r /home/ubuntu/custom/zdc-core-addons
|
|
multipass exec $NAME -- sudo rm -r /home/ubuntu/custom/zdc-oca-addons
|
|
|
|
echo "### Clone new repositories"
|
|
multipass exec $NAME -- /usr/bin/git clone git@gitea.egroup.sk:development/zdc-odoo --depth 1 --branch master /home/ubuntu/odoo12
|
|
multipass exec $NAME -- /usr/bin/git clone git@gitea.egroup.sk:development/zdc-core-addons --depth 1 --branch master /home/ubuntu/custom/zdc-core-addons
|
|
multipass exec $NAME -- /usr/bin/git clone git@gitea.egroup.sk:development/zdc-oca-addons --depth 1 --branch master /home/ubuntu/custom/zdc-oca-addons
|
|
|
|
echo "### Start odoo service"
|
|
multipass exec $NAME -- sudo systemctl start odoo12
|